Stock Photo - Young people create a community garden in the lower ninth ward, hoping to turn vacant lots devastated by Hurricane Katrina into an urban farm that will provide learning opportunities for area youth and fresh produce for the neighborhood; Nat Turner, left, a former New York teacher who is organizing the project, explains how they are growing potatoes in old tires, New Orleans, Louisiana, USA
